    Microsoft 365: Shifts for Teams

    Shifts in Microsoft Teams is a schedule management tool that helps you create, update, and manage schedules for your team. Shifts has you covered whether you are putting together a schedule for your team or swapping shifts with a teammate.

    Microsoft 365: Assignments for Teams

    Assignments in Teams allow educators to assign tasks, work, or quizzes to their learners. Educators can manage assignment timelines, instructions, add resources to turn in, grade with rubrics, and more. They can also track class and individual learner progress in the Grades tab.

    Cisco Jabber UC Training: Group Chats

    You can send a group chat invite to chat with more than one person at a time. These conversations are not saved by Cisco Jabber, if you close the chat window, you will lose the chat history. Note: If you have a need to maintain chat history for collaboration, Microsoft Teams provides persistent chat history, please visit the Microsoft Teams Training page for more information.

    Cisco Jabber UC Training: Video Conference

    To start a video conference call, you will need to either (1) join one of our on-premise video conferencing bridges or (2) know the conference room's SIP URI so that you can dial the room directly. Note: The on-premise bridges and the conference room URIs look like email addresses.
